1. A computer monitor visor for mounting on a computer monitor having a top wall, a back wall, a first side wall, a second side wall and a forward surface having a video display screen, said computer monitor visor comprising:

  • a top panel having an upper surface, a rear portion, a first edge and a second edge, said rear portion being for resting on a computer monitor top wall, said first edge being for lateral extension towards a computer monitor first side wall, said second edge being for lateral extension towards a computer monitor second side wall;

    an elongate computer attachment strap having a top panel attachment end and a monitor attachment end, said top panel attachment ends being coupled to said top panel upper surface, said monitor attachment ends being for attachment to a computer monitor back wall;

    a first side panel having an inner surface, an outer surface, said first side panel being downwardly depended from said top panel first edge;

    an elongate first support brace having a clip end and a base end, said first support brace clip end being coupled to said first side panel, said first support brace base end being for resting on a surface;

    a first side attachment strap having a top panel end and a first side panel end, said first side attachment strap top panel end being coupled to said top panel upper surface, said first side attachment strap first side panel end being coupled to said first side panel outer surface;

    a second side panel having an inner surface, an outer surface, said second side panel being downwardly depended from said top panel second edge, said second side panel interior surface facing said first side panel interior surface;

    an elongate second support brace having a clip end and a base end, said second support brace clip end being coupled to said second side panel, said second support brace base end being for resting on a surface; and

    a second side attachment strap having a top panel end and a second side panel end, said second side attachment strap top panel end being coupled to said top panel upper surface, said second side attachment strap second side panel end being coupled to said second side panel outer surface.
